Default 100K miles in 3 years Vs 100K miles in 8 years.

I am just looking for some opinion on a car with which has 100K miles in 3 years (its not an integra though...its an Acura MDX). If its a well maintained car ( regular oil changes, 30,60 major services etc), in my opinion the overall condition of the car should be much better than of a car with 100k miles in 8 years and this 100K miles should not be an issue....Atleast 75K miles should be from pure high way miles where the wear and tear is very very less.

My thought is that, it may be a good idea to go for high mileage cars that has put in the miles in a relatively shorter time frame. Of course there are certain components which are directly proportional to the miles you have like tires, brake pads etc...But the overall condition should be OK if the miles are accrued in a shorter time period. Not many cold engine starts (for a car with 100k in 3 years, averaging 4 starts a day you end up with around 4,500 cold starts in a 3 year period where as for a car which has put in these many miles in a 8 year period, its going to be 12,000 starts).

As long as you have the maintenance and service records, the newer car will be better. Items like rubber boots and bushings as well as interiors, tend to wear out due to exposure to the elements and heat cycling, so they will be in better shape than another vehicle with similar mileage, but is 5 years older.
